For years, the federal solar rebate stopped dead at 100 kilowatts. Under that ceiling, a business got the same upfront point-of-sale discount that homeowners enjoy. One kilowatt over it, and the discount vanished entirely. So businesses did the rational thing: they put 99.9kW systems on warehouse roofs that could comfortably carry three or four times that, and kept buying the rest of their daytime power from the grid.

That cliff is being removed. From 1 October 2026, the federal Small-scale Renewable Energy Scheme will cover commercial solar systems all the way up to 1 megawatt, a tenfold increase. The Government reckons it takes around 20% off the installed cost of a medium-sized system, and it describes the roofs it is targeting as Australia’s “missing middle”: the factories, warehouses, cold stores, farm sheds and shopping centres that sit between household rooftops and utility-scale solar farms.

It is a genuinely big change for anyone with a large roof and a daytime electricity habit. Here is what actually changed, what the discount is worth, who stands to gain the most, and the fine print worth knowing before you sign anything.

What actually changed

The mechanism itself is not new. Small-scale solar earns Small-scale Technology Certificates, or STCs, which your installer typically sells on your behalf and passes back to you as an upfront discount on the invoice. It is the same scheme behind the “rebate” on a household 6.6kW system. The only thing that has moved is the size limit: the point where a system stops qualifying as small-scale has been lifted from 100kW to 1MW.

That sounds like a technicality. In practice it removes a distortion that has been shaping commercial roofs for years. The 100kW cap was a hard edge, not a taper, so the sensible move was to design right up to 99.9kW and stop, even on a roof begging for more. Lifting the ceiling to 1MW lets a business size a system to the roof and to its actual daytime load, rather than to a rebate threshold. The Government puts the untapped opportunity at more than 80GW of commercial rooftop potential against only around 5.6GW installed so far.

What the rebate is worth

The discount scales with system size, at roughly 20% of the installed cost. The Government offered two worked examples when it announced the change: a retailer installing a 250kW system saving close to $70,000, and a large retail complex or logistics warehouse saving more than $230,000 on an 850kW system. At the same rate, a 400kW system lands at roughly $110,000 off the upfront price.

The table below is a rough guide at that rate. STCs are traded on an open market, so the real figure moves with the certificate price on the day, your solar zone and your installer’s pricing. Treat it as a sense of scale, not a quote.

System sizeIndicative upfront discountNotes
100 kWaround $27,000The old ceiling
250 kWaround $70,000Government example
400 kWaround $110,000At the same rate
850 kWmore than $230,000Government example

The upfront discount is only part of the return. A commercial solar system also cuts your daily power bill, and businesses can generally claim depreciation on the asset, which sharpens the after-tax payback further. Who benefits most

The winners are easy to spot: a big roof paired with high daytime consumption. Solar pays back fastest when you use the power yourself as it is generated, rather than exporting it for a modest feed-in tariff, so the best fit is a business that runs hard through the middle of the day and has the roof or ground space to match.

Cold storage and refrigerated food businesses are a particularly neat fit, because their heaviest load, the compressors, runs all day and peaks in the same summer heat that drives the best solar output. The same logic applies to any operation whose plant hums from nine to five. If most of your consumption lands after dark, solar alone does less for you, and the conversation shifts towards pairing it with storage.

The NSW angle: stacking with the Peak Demand Reduction Scheme

You will see it claimed that NSW businesses can “stack” the expanded rebate with Peak Reduction Certificates under the state’s Peak Demand Reduction Scheme. That is true, but it is worth being precise about what earns what, because the wording often implies more than it should.

Your solar panels earn federal STCs. The NSW Peak Demand Reduction Scheme does not pay for solar generation at all; it rewards cutting demand during peak periods, which in practice usually means a battery. So the way the two actually stack is that a business installing solar and a battery claims federal STCs on the solar and NSW Peak Reduction Certificates (PRCs) on the battery. Two schemes, two pieces of equipment, both claimable on the one project. What you cannot do is earn PRCs on the solar array itself.

Faster grid connections

For a lot of mid-scale projects, the upfront cost was never the only barrier. Getting the network to approve a larger connection has been slow and unpredictable, and an uncertain connection timeline can stall a business case just as effectively as a big invoice. Alongside the rebate change, the Government has said it will ask the Australian Energy Market Commission to require network providers to approve commercial and industrial connections more quickly.

That reform still has to work its way through, and it does not remove the need to apply. But it signals that the connection queue, not just the price, is finally being treated as part of the problem. If you are scoping a larger system, start the connection conversation with your network and installer early, because that timeline often sets the pace of the whole project.

The fine print worth knowing

First, the timing. The expanded eligibility applies from 1 October 2026. Because the certificates are created around when the system is installed and confirmed, a job above 100kW that is finished too early could fall under the old rules. If you are planning a larger system, talk to your installer about how the build schedule lines up with the start date so you claim the full entitlement.

Second, the value is not fixed. STCs trade on an open market and the number of certificates a system creates is set to keep declining each year until the small-scale scheme ends in 2030, so the discount is generally worth more the sooner you act. We cover that wind-down in detail in our guide on what the STC phase-out means.

Third, keep the quoting honest. A larger job is a larger cheque, and that is exactly where loose pricing hides. Ask for the STC discount shown as a separate line, get the system sized to your roof and load rather than to a headline number, and compare two or three quotes. A legitimate installer will happily break the numbers down.

What to do now

If you have a big roof and you run through the day, this is worth pricing properly. Start by looking at your consumption profile: the more of your usage that falls in daylight hours, the stronger the case, because self-consumed solar is worth far more than exported solar. Then size the system to that load and the available roof, not to the old 100kW line.

From there it is the usual discipline. Get the connection conversation moving early, get itemised quotes with the discount shown separately, and, if you are in NSW and adding storage, work out the PRC side as its own line rather than folding it into a vague “rebate” number. The rebate has done the hard part by removing the cliff. The rest is sizing the system to your business and quoting it cleanly.
